Inspiration
The inspiration behind GenAI stems from a deep empathy for those struggling with emotional challenges. Witnessing the power of technology to foster connections, we envisioned an AI companion capable of providing genuine emotional support.
What it does
GenAI is your compassionate emotional therapy AI friend. It provides a safe space for users to express their feelings, offering empathetic responses, coping strategies, and emotional support. It understands users' emotions, offering personalized guidance to improve mental well-being. Additional functions: 1) Emotions recognition & control 2) Control of the level of lies and ethics 3) Speaking partner 4) Future optional video chat with the AI-generated person 5) Future meeting notetaker
How we built it
GenAI was meticulously crafted using cutting-edge natural language processing and machine learning algorithms. Extensive research on emotional intelligence and human psychology informed our algorithms. Continuous user feedback played a pivotal role in refining GenAI’s responses, making them truly empathetic and supportive.
Challenges we ran into
Integrating emotional analysis APIs seamlessly into GenAI was vital for its functionality. We faced difficulties in finding a reliable API that could accurately interpret and respond to users' emotions. After rigorous testing, we successfully integrated an API that met our high standards, ensuring GenAI's emotional intelligence. Training LLMs posed another challenge. We needed GenAI to understand context, tone, and emotion intricately. This required extensive training and fine-tuning of the language models. It demanded significant computational resources and time, but the result was an AI friend that could comprehend and respond to users with empathy and depth. Connecting the front end, developed using React, with the backend, powered by Jupyter Notebook, was a complex task. Ensuring real-time, seamless communication between the two was essential for GenAI's responsiveness. We implemented robust data pipelines and optimized API calls to guarantee swift and accurate exchanges, enabling GenAI to provide instant emotional support.
Accomplishments that we're proud of
1) Genuine Empathy: GenAI delivers authentic emotional support, fostering a sense of connection. 2) User Impact: Witnessing positive changes in users’ lives reaffirms the significance of our mission. 3) Continuous Improvement: Regular updates and enhancements ensure GenAI remains effective and relevant.
What we learned
Throughout the journey, we learned the profound impact of artificial intelligence on mental health. Understanding emotions, building a responsive interface, and ensuring user trust were pivotal lessons. The power of compassionate technology became evident as GenAI evolved.
What's next for GenAI
Our journey doesn't end here. We aim to: 1) Expand Features: Introduce new therapeutic modules tailored to diverse user needs. 2) Global Accessibility: Translate GenAI into multiple languages, making it accessible worldwide. 3) Collaborate with Experts: Partner with psychologists to enhance GenAI's effectiveness. 4) Research Advancements: Stay abreast of the latest research to continually improve GenAI’s empathetic capabilities. GenAI is not just a project; it's a commitment to mental well-being, blending technology and empathy to create a brighter, emotionally healthier future.
Built With
- ai
- anaconda
- api
- flask
- hume
- javascript
- jupyter
- ml
- python
- react
Log in or sign up for Devpost to join the conversation.